Defining the 6mm Threaded Rod
Simply put, a 6mm threaded rod is a long, cylindrical steel rod with helical threads running along its entire length, specifically 6 millimeters in diameter. It acts like a giant bolt without a head, designed to fasten things firmly when used with nuts and washers. While this sounds straightforward, these rods serve as core components in load-bearing and tension applications.

Key Aspects of 6mm Threaded Rods
Durability
Engineered usually from high-grade carbon steel, stainless steel, or alloy steel, these rods withstand corrosion, tensile stress, and environmental wear. Durability ensures long-term reliability in harsh outdoor or industrial settings, say, coastal wind farms or remote factories. Without that, structures risk failure or costly maintenance.
Scalability & Versatility
Available in custom lengths and thread pitches, 6mm threaded rods adapt well to diverse engineering needs. Scaffolding, electrical enclosures, or automotive assemblies all benefit. Oddly enough, their standard metric sizing means you can source comparable rods worldwide, critical for global projects and emergency relief.
Cost Efficiency
The fusion of simple design with mass manufacturing makes these rods affordable yet reliable. They reduce the cost of logistics and installation while maintaining high performance. For NGOs or small businesses, this balance often determines project feasibility.
Ease of Use
6mm rods allow quick assembly with basic tools—nobody's fiddling with complex gearboxes here. This ease translates to lower training requirements for onsite workers and faster build times.
| Specification | Details |
|---|---|
| Diameter | 6 mm (M6) |
| Length | From 100 mm to 1,000 mm (custom available) |
| Material | Carbon steel, Stainless steel, Alloy steel |
| Thread Pitch | Standard: 1.0mm pitch (fine/coarse variants available) |
| Tensile Strength | 400-800 MPa depending on grade |
| Common Finish | Zinc plating, Hot-dip galvanized |

Common Challenges and How to Overcome Them
Let’s face it: not every threaded rod out there is created equal. Sometimes quality varies, and poorly finished rods can rust quickly or strip threads in heavy use. Sourcing mismatches in international projects can cause delays or incompatible nuts.
Experts recommend rigorous testing standards (like ISO 898-1 for mechanical properties) and working with trusted vendors who offer traceability certifications. Custom packaging and pre-inspection reduce waste and site delays.
FAQs About 6mm Threaded Rods
Q1: What’s the difference between coarse and fine threading on a 6mm rod?
A: Coarse threads (standard pitch 1.0mm) offer quicker assembly and better resistance to damage in softer materials. Fine threads provide higher tensile strength and are great when precise adjustment is needed. Your application dictates the choice.
Q2: Can 6mm threaded rods be used outdoors without rusting?
A: Yes, if made from stainless steel or with protective coatings like hot-dip galvanizing or zinc plating. Regular carbon steel rods are prone to rust outdoors unless treated.
Q3: How do I choose the right length for a 6mm threaded rod?
A: Consider the thickness of the materials you're joining plus allowances for nuts and washers on both ends. Common lengths range from 100mm to 1000mm, but custom sizes are also available.
Q4: Is it possible to cut 6mm rods to size onsite?
A: Absolutely. These rods can be cut with standard metal cutting saws. Just ensure thread ends are cleaned or re-threaded if necessary before installation.
